This cozy re-creation of a Jazz Age nightspot offers American fare, classic cocktails & live jazz.

This place was absolutely magical. I love a speakeasy and especially with a thorough theme. When you walk through the door of the Bookstore Speakeasy you feel like you’re going back in time. All of the decor gives you plenty to look at. If you’re coming with a group I recommend making a reservation the space isn’t really large and it seems like on busy nights, they won’t be able to accommodate walkins. We were lucky enough to go see it at the bar, which is the best place to get all of the suggestions from the amazing bartender, Max. Shaniece was a wonderful server.

They have something for everyone whether you want something sweet, boozy, citrus, or floral. Max make some experimentations based on what you are eating or your flavor pallet. We enjoyed the coconut shrimp and also the rum punch, a scotch cocktail, and a dessert spirit. I cannot wait to return.

We went for our anniversary and we were not disappointed. The ambience was that of a period speakeasy with a “bookstore” in the front and the restaurant and bar in the back. Food and drink menus, rules, receipts were all in books. Along with the history of the place. I had a great time. Live music is always a treat.
We dressed up because it was a special event, but no pressure to do too much in the future.
We had the fries for the appetizer and forgot about to take a pic of main meal. Portions weren’t huge, but no need.
We will definitely go back.
